In this insightful episode of "Close It Now," Sam Wakefield takes you on a journey to discover how the power of language can revolutionize your results in sales, recruiting, and life. Sam dives into the mindset that separates the top performers in the HVAC industry from the rest, emphasizing the significance of word choice in shaping our interactions and outcomes. He shares a groundbreaking perspective on how simple word substitutions can dramatically impact your sales approach and effectiveness. The episode also explores the vital balance between work and home life, offering strategies for being fully present with your loved ones while excelling in your career. Sam’s practical advice and motivational insights are based on real-world experiences and are designed to empower HVAC professionals to achieve exceptional success by transforming their approach to communication and mindset. Tune in to "Change Your Language and It Will Change Your Results" for a transformative experience that will elevate your professional and personal life.
